Troubleshooting
Read instruction manual first! Remove plug from the power source before
making adjustments or assembling the blade.
PROBLEM REMEDY
SAW WILL NOT START
1. Power cord is not plugged in.
2. Power source fuse or circuit break-
er tripped.
3. Cord damaged.
4. Burned out switch.
5. Trigger does not turn tool on.
1. Plug saw in.
2. Replace fuse or reset tripped circuit breaker.
3. Inspect cord for damage. If damaged, have cord re-
placed by an Authorized Bosch Service Center or
Service Station.
4. Have switch replaced by an Authorized Bosch Ser-
vice Center or Service Station.
5. Have switch replaced by an Authorized Bosch Ser-
vice Center or Service Station.
BLADE DOES NOT COME UP TO SPEED
1. Extension cord too light or too long.
2. Low house voltage.
1. Replace with adequate cord.
2. Contact your electric company.
EXCESSIVE VIBRATION
1. Blade out of balance.
2. Workpiece not clamped or sup-
ported properly.
1. Discard Blade and use different blade.
2. Clamp or support workpiece as shown on pages
12 - 14.
CUT BINDS, BURNS, STALLS MOTOR WHEN RIPPING
1. Dull blade with improper tooth set.
2. Warped sheet.
3. Blade binds.
4. Improper workpiece support.
1. Discard blade and use a different blade.
2. Make sure concave or hollow side is facing DOWN.
Feed slowly. See page 12.
3. Assemble blade and tighten Vari-Torque clutch per
Assembly Instructions”, see page 10.
4. Clamp or support workpiece as shown on pages
12 - 14.
BLADE SLIPPING
1. Tool does not cut workpiece. 1. Assemble blade and tighten Vari-Torque clutch per
Assembly Instructions”, see page 10.
